shuffle [shuhf-uhl]
verb
1. To walk without lifting the feet or with clumsy steps and a shambling gait.
 
2. To scrape the feet over the floor in dancing.
 
3. To move clumsily (usually followed by into ).
 
4. To act underhandedly or evasively with respect to a stated situation (often followed by in, into,  or out of ).
 
5. To intermix so as to change the relative positions of cards in a pack.
